Facilities Manager

Facilities ManagerOur Global Life Sciences client is looking for a Facilities Manager to join them on a contract basis. You will manage various aspects of Facilities management on site, including management of all outsourced activities.
Accountabilities
- Manage the Facilities Management contract at a site level and oversee the services to ensure they are being delivered to specification and end-user satisfaction (security, engineering maintenance, cleaning, catering, HVAC and Real Estate).
- Working with the HSE team to satisfy regulatory and corporate requirements.
- Key team member driving routine Governance and the continual improvement of the FM provision.
- Executing the site's Sustainability and well-being agenda
- Liaising with GFM supplier organisation, business partners, key internal stakeholders and external contacts to support an effective delivery of the local operations.
- Review the supplier delivery against the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and Service Level Agreements (SLAs) for the site with the GFM supplier and Area and/or Regional Lead.
- Manage Real Estate transitions associated with their sites.
- responsible for delivering certain FM-related projects on time, cost and quality.
- Support the Project teams delivery of Capital, Maintenance and Operational projects performed on the site(s) in scope (where applicable).
Critical Experience Required:
- Fluent in English and any additional language necessary to effectively manage in the territory. Other languages are beneficial.
- Hard and Soft Facilities Management experience
- Comprehensive working knowledge of the contracts management about the provision of services to the site, including the related service level agreements and key performance indicators.
- Good knowledge of Health & Safety requirements and how they can best be implemented.
- Computer literate.
- Experience working in Site Services functions.
- Experience in managing 3rd party suppliers, including contract management and the operation of SLAs and KPIs.
- Experience in managing within budgets.
- Excellent communication skills, with both internal customers and external suppliers.
- Able to plan and organize work to meet deadlines whilst maintaining some flexibility to manage changing demands.
